Excrescence:  noun from the Latin excrescentia meaning to grow out

  1. An outgrowth or enlargement, especially an abnormal one, such as a wart.
  2. A disfiguring, extraneous, or unwanted mark or part
  3. A normal outgrowth on the body such as finger nails and hair
  4. A usually unwanted or unnecessary accretion: a bulge on a building

Mushrooms are excrescence of an underground fungus network.

Pulchritude:  noun from the Latin pulchritudo meaning beauty

  1. physical comeliness, beauty, loveliness

Her pulchritude required effort not to stare.
